Travel Tips

  • ⛰ Embrace the Local Culture

    Before flying from Beijing to Hohhot, familiarize yourself with Mongolian customs and traditions. Learning a few key phrases in Mongolian, such as 'Sain baina uu' (Hello) or 'Bayarlalaa' (Thank you), can enhance your interactions and show respect to the local culture.

  • 📍 Prepare for Altitude Adjustments

    Hohhot is located at a higher altitude than Beijing, so be prepared for potential altitude sickness. Stay hydrated before and during the flight, and consider avoiding alcohol. Also, pack snacks rich in carbs to help with the adjustment.

  • 🚍 Check Local Weather Conditions

    Hohhot experiences varied weather, especially during the summer and winter. Check the local forecast before your trip and pack accordingly, as temperatures can drop significantly in winter, affecting what you wear and bring.

  • 🎭 Utilize In-Flight Entertainment

    On flights to Hohhot, many airlines offer local films or culinary features that highlight Inner Mongolian culture. Take this opportunity to learn more about the region’s heritage and perhaps get inspired for activities once you arrive.

  • 🏛 Plan Your Arrival

    Upon reaching Hohhot, consider pre-arranging airport transfers as public transport options might be limited. Research local taxi services or consider ridesharing apps for a smooth transition upon arrival.
